Worldview
Top Stories
Latest
Countries
People
Search
John Steenhuisen
South African politician
more on Wikipedia
South Africa: John Steenhuisen named Democratic Alliance leader - Al Jazeera English
UK
South Africa
4yrs
South Africa: John Steenhuisen named Democratic Alliance leader
South Africa
4yrs
New leader for largest opposition party in SA
5yrs
Petition launched for Ramaphosa to appear before Zondo - John Steenhuisen - POLITICS | Politics...
6yrs
Related countries
South Africa
UK
Related people
Ramaphosa
Zondo
John Steenhuisen Politicsweb Full
Steenhuisen
Mmusi Maimane